GREEK STYLE BEEF SKILLET



Greek Style Beef Skillet image

For a taste of Greece, this one-dish complete meal is sure to be a hit. Feta cheese accents the authentic flavor.This recipe is courtesy of McCormick.

Yield 6

Number Of Ingredients 11

1 pound ground beef
1/2 cup chopped onion
2 teaspoon mccormick® oregano leaves
1 teaspoon mccormick® ground cinnamon
1/2 teaspoon mccormick® garlic powder
1 can of reduced sodium beef broth
1 can of diced tomatoes, undrained
2 tablespoon tomato paste
1 1/2 cup uncooked penne pasta
1 1/2 cup frozen leaf spinach, thawed
3/4 cup crumbled feta cheese, divided

Steps:

  • Cook ground beef and onion in large skillet on medium-high heat until beef is no longer pink, stirring occasionally.
  • Drain fat.
  • Add oregano, cinnamon and garlic powder; mix well.
  • Stir in broth, tomatoes and tomato paste.
  • Bring to boil.
  • Stir in pasta.
  • Reduce heat to medium; cover and cook 10 minutes or until pasta is nearly tender.
  • Stir in spinach and 1/2 cup of the feta cheese.
  • Cover.
  • Cook 5 minutes longer or until pasta is tender.
  • Sprinkle with remaining 1/4 cup feta cheese.
  • Cover.
  • Let stand 5 minutes.

EASY GREEK SKILLET DINNER



Easy Greek Skillet Dinner image

This is a delicious and easy one-dish dinner with a Greek flair. It's also well-balanced and light - and my kids love it. What more could you want?

Yield 6

Number Of Ingredients 10

½ pound dried elbow macaroni
1 pound lean ground beef
2 cloves garlic, pressed or minced
2 medium carrots, quartered lengthwise and sliced
1 large zucchini, quartered lengthwise and sliced
1 ½ tablespoons dried oregano leaves
salt and pepper
1 (10.75 ounce) can condensed tomato soup, plus
1 (10.75 ounce) can water
1 ounce crumbled feta cheese

Steps:

  • Bring a large pot of lightly salted water to a boil. Cook elbow macaroni for 8 to 10 minutes or until al dente; drain, and set aside.
  • Brown ground beef with garlic in a large skillet over medium heat. Strain off fat, if necessary. When meat is lightly browned, add carrots and cook until tender, about 5 minutes. Stir in zucchini and oregano, and continue cooking another 5 minutes. Season to taste with salt and pepper.
  • When vegetables are tender, stir in tomato soup, water, and prepared elbow macaroni, and cook for another 5 to 10 minutes. Serve with crumbled feta cheese on top, if desired.

GREEK-STYLE PASTA SKILLET



Greek-Style Pasta Skillet image

You can turn this into an Italian style dish by omitting the cinnamon and using diced tomatoes with basil, garlic and oregano other than plain tomatoes and substitute mozzarella cheese for the feta.

Yield 4 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 11

12 ounces lean ground beef
1 medium onion, chopped
1 (14 1/2 ounce) can diced tomatoes, undrained
1 (5 1/2 ounce) can tomato juice
1/2 cup water
1/2 teaspoon beef bouillon granules
1/2 teaspoon ground cinnamon
1/8 teaspoon garlic powder
1 cup dried medium pasta shells or 1 cup elbow macaroni
1 cup frozen cut green beans
1/2 cup crumbled feta cheese (2 oz.)

Steps:

  • In a large skillet cook ground meat and onion until meat is brown and onion is tender. Drain off fat.
  • Stir in tomatoes, tomato juice, water, beef bouillon granules, cinnamon and garlic powder. Bring to boiling.
  • Stir uncooked pasta and green beans into meat mixture. Return to boiling; reduce heat.
  • Cover and simmer about 15 minutes or until pasta and green beans are tender. Sprinkle with cheese.

GREEK TORTELLINI SKILLET

Yield 6 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 11

1 package (19 ounces) frozen cheese tortellini
1 pound ground beef
1 medium zucchini, sliced
1 small red onion, chopped
3 cups marinara or spaghetti sauce
1/2 cup water
1/4 teaspoon pepper
2 medium tomatoes, chopped
1/2 cup cubed feta cheese
1/2 cup pitted Greek olives, halved
2 tablespoons minced fresh basil, divided

Steps:

  • Cook tortellini according to package directions. Meanwhile, in a large skillet, cook the beef, zucchini and onion over medium heat until meat is no longer pink; drain., Drain tortellini; add to skillet. Stir in the marinara sauce, water and pepper. Bring to a boil. Reduce heat; simmer, uncovered, for 5 minutes. Add the tomatoes, cheese, olives and 1 tablespoon basil. Sprinkle with remaining basil.

GREEK BEEF STEAK

Yield 4-6 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 9

3 lbs thin sliced beef (any kind)
1/2 cup oil
2 cups red wine
6 cloves minced garlic (, depending on taste- may add more or less)
1/2 cup vinegar
1 tablespoon sugar
4 cups water
flour (for dredging)
salt and pepper

Steps:

  • Heat oil in a skillet.
  • Dredge the beef in flour mixed with salt and pepper.
  • Brown the beef till just browned.
  • Meanwhile, combine the wine, garlic, vinegar, sugar, and water in a stockpot.
  • Add the browned beef including skillet scrapings.
  • Bring to a boil, then reduce heat and simmer for 1 1/2 hours, adding water and stirring when neccessary.
  • This recipe makes its own gravy, so goes well with rice, potatoes, or bread.

GREEK-STYLE SKILLET SUPPER

Yield 4 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 11

1/2 lb ground beef
1/2 cup chopped onion
1 (14 1/2 ounce) can beef broth
1 1/2 cups penne pasta (uncooked)
1 (14 1/2 ounce) can diced tomatoes
1 1/2 cups frozen cut green beans
2 tablespoons tomato paste
2 teaspoons oregano leaves
1/2 teaspoon ground cinnamon
1/2 teaspoon garlic powder
3/4 cup crumbled feta cheese, divided

Steps:

  • In large skillet, brown beef with onion over medium-high heat.
  • Drain fat.
  • Add broth; bring to boil.
  • Stir in pasta.
  • Return to boil and simmer, covered, 8 minutes.
  • Stir in remaining ingredients except cheese.
  • Return to boil.
  • Stir in 1/2 cut feta cheese.
  • Simmer, uncovered, 7-10 min.
  • until sauce thickens slightly.
  • Sprinkle with remaining feta cheese.

GREEK-STYLE BEEF STEW (STIFADO)



Greek-Style Beef Stew (Stifado) image

Tender beef and sweet shallots in a tangy, aromatic sauce make my version of beef stifado one you'll surely want to try! Be sure to serve it with crusty bread to dip in the sauce. Top the stew with crumbled feta and pickled red onions, or serve it on top of my Greek Spinach Rice.

Yield 6

Number Of Ingredients 19

3 pounds boneless beef chuck roast, cut into 2-inch cubes
2 teaspoons freshly ground black pepper
1 tablespoon kosher salt
4 tablespoons olive oil, divided
1 pound small shallots
½ cup diced onion
4 cloves garlic, minced
1 pinch kosher salt
3 tablespoons tomato paste
¼ cup red wine vinegar
1 cup white wine
2 teaspoons white sugar
¼ teaspoon ground cinnamon
⅛ teaspoon ground allspice
1 pinch ground cloves
1 teaspoon dried oregano
2 large bay leaves
2 sprigs fresh rosemary
2 cups beef broth, or more as needed

Steps:

  • Place beef in a bowl and season generously with pepper and kosher salt. Cover and transfer to the refrigerator until ready to use; up to 1 day is fine.
  • Leaving the root ends in place, cut off the shallot tops. Remove and discard skins.
  • Heat 2 tablespoons oil in a heavy skillet over high heat. Add ½ of the beef and cook until nicely seared, 4 to 6 minutes per side. Remove to a plate and repeat to sear remaining beef.
  • Turn off the heat and add 1 tablespoon oil to the empty skillet. Add shallots and let the skillet cool for 2 to 3 minutes. Turn the heat back on to medium and toss shallots until browned, 2 to 4 minutes. Remove shallots to a plate.
  • Add the remaining 1 tablespoon oil to the skillet with onion, garlic, and a pinch of salt; cook and stir for about 1 minute. Stir in tomato paste and cook until toasted, about 2 minutes. Add red wine vinegar and white wine and bring to a boil while scraping the browned bits of food off the bottom of the pan with a wooden spoon. Increase heat to medium-high and add sugar, cinnamon, allspice, cloves, oregano, bay leaves, and rosemary sprigs. Stir to combine and cook until reduced by about half, 2 to 3 minutes.
  • Add browned beef and shallots to the skillet and toss carefully until coated. Pour in 2 cups beef broth and bring to a simmer.
  • Reduce heat to low or medium-low. Cover and cook at a gentle simmer for 1 hour, then uncover and cook for at least 1 more hour, stirring occasionally to move the beef and shallots around. Add more broth if needed during the cooking time and skim off some fat if preferred. The meat is done when a fork slides in easily, but the meat isn't falling apart on its own; it may take longer than 2 hours.
  • Taste and adjust seasonings before serving.
